ESLint:避免嵌套三元表达式

时间:2018-04-13 15:36:19

标签: javascript ternary-operator eslint

我有这个功能:

foo(number) {
    this.navDropdowns = this.navDropdowns.map((item, index) =>
      (index === number
        ? item ? true : !item
        : false));
  },

ESLint不允许嵌套我的表达式,表明index出现了问题。有什么猜测怎么避免这个?

0 个答案:

没有答案